Kansas Department of Transportation 

The Kansas Department of Transportation announces approved bids for state highway construction and maintenance projects. The letting took place on May 20 in Topeka. Some of the bids may include multiple projects that have been bundled based on proximity and type of work.

District Three — Northwest

Smith ‑ 92 C‑5360‑01 – Bridge over East Beaver Creek, located 2.0 miles south and 3.0 miles west of Smith Center, bridge replacement, 0.5 mile, L & M Contractors Inc., Great Bend, Kansas, $783,676.75.

Statewide ‑ 106 KA‑7645‑01 – K‑247, K‑255, U.S. 183 and U.S. 183 Bypass in Ellis, Rooks, Russell, Rush and Trego counties, signing, Martin Outdoor Enterprises Inc., Pittsburg, Kansas, $269,131.20.

District Four — Southeast

Crawford ‑ 19 TE‑0575‑01 – East 20th Street, from North Rouse Street to North Home Avenue in Pittsburg, pedestrian and bicycle paths, 0.5 mile, Mission Construction Co. Inc., St. Paul, Kansas, $297,453.50.

Labette ‑ 166‑50 KA‑7241‑01 – U.S. 166, at five locations from 0.09 mile east of the Montgomery/Labette county line east to 0.40 mile west of Queens Road, guard fence, 15.8 miles, Martin Outdoor Enterprises Inc., Pittsburg, Kansas, $793,994.78.

District Five — South Central

Barber ‑ 4 C‑5344‑01 – Bridge over Spring Creek, located 2.8 miles east of Sharon, bridge replacement, 0.2 mile, L & M Contractors Inc., Great Bend, Kansas, $366,484.40.

Barber ‑ 4 C‑5322‑01 – RS 31, from 3.5 miles south of U.S. 160 to U.S. 160, guard fence, 3.5 miles, L & M Contractors Inc., Great Bend, Kansas, $593,111.85.

Barber ‑ 2‑4 KA‑7216‑01 – K‑2, at four locations from 0.57 mile northeast of Hawkins Road northeast to 0.09 mile southwest of Catalpa Road, guard fence, 5.2 miles, Wildcat Construction Co Inc & Subsidiaries, Wichita, Kansas, $1,862,679.26.

Barton ‑ 4‑5 KA‑7217‑01 – K‑4, from 0.22 mile east of northeast 120 Avenue, guard fence, 0.2 mile, Wildcat Construction Co Inc & Subsidiaries, Wichita, Kansas, $538,957.50.

Butler ‑ 400‑8 KA‑7995‑01 – U.S. 400, culverts from just east of the city of Leon to east of just west of the city of Beaumont, culvert, 11.0 miles, US Infra Rehab Services, LLC, North Chesterfield, Virginia, $567,960.63.

Kingman ‑ 14‑48 KA‑7218‑01 – K‑14, from 0.31 mile south of 120 Street, guard fence, 0.2 mile, PSE Contractors LLC, Wichita, Kansas, $277,661.60.

District Six — Southwest

Haskell ‑ 41 C‑5318‑01 – All Minor Collectors, signing, 44.9 miles, Martin Outdoor Enterprises Inc., Pittsburg, Kansas, $59,894.25.
